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H4136
Hebrew: מוּל
Transliteration: mûwl
Pronunciation: mool
Part of Speech: Noun Masculine
Bible Usage: (over) {against} {before} [fore-] {front} {from} [God-] {ward} {toward} with.
Definition:
properly {abrupt} that {is} a precipice; by implication the front; used only adverbially (with prepositional prefix) opposite
1. front
a. front
b. in the opposite direction prep
2. in front of
a. in front of
b. (with prefix)
1. towards the front of, to the front of, on the front of
2. from the front of, off the front of, close in front of, on the forefront of
